Turmoil on Turkish markets following the detainment of Istanbul's mayor. Turkey's budget deficit has skyrocketed and its currency has plunged to a record low. American spenders are feeling anxious about inflation. So will the US Federal Reserve hold interest rates? Plus Andrew Peach finds out why Ben & Jerry's says its Chief Executive has been ousted by its parent company Unilever.
